Key Highlights

  • The online retail market includes all sales within Clothing & Footwear, Electricals, Food & Grocery, Health & Beauty, Home and Other (Books, News & Stationery, Jewelry & Watches, Luggage & Leather Goods, Music, Video & Entertainment Software, Sports & Leisure Equipment and others) segments, provided they take place over the internet, where the payment does not occur in-store on a later occasion. Data is included irrespective of whether the vendor is a pure-play internet company or the online offering of a bricks and mortar retailer. Online specialists retailers include sell only via the internet. Other online retail is a sell done online by retailers that also operate via offline channels (in-store, mail order, direct selling, etc.)
  • The US online retail market had total revenues of $901,677.7m in 2021, representing a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 19.2% between 2017 and 2021.
  • Online Specialists account for the largest proportion of sales in the US online retail market in 2021, sales through this channel generated $453,386.9m, equivalent to 50.3% of the market's overall value.
  • The online retail market is supported by the country’s robust technology infrastructure, which ensures the availability of high-speed Internet as well as a significant number of tech-savvy customers.
